Polar Bear Brew Day is Saturday February 24th at 10am. Bring your equipment and brew with us. If you’re an all grain brewer you’ll probably want to arrive as close to 10am as possible, but if you’re extract well you can start whenever. We’ll have all the filtered water and chiller water that you’ll need so no need to bring your own. If you just want to watch and drink beer then you can come and do that too. Bring homebrews and/or commercial beers, and food to share. Kris is going to try and have his kegerator ready to go by then so you can also bring Cornelius kegs as well if you’d like.
